Output 56813e30cb22e0d7f00587659dae819d94e427372102c57f5d57d64f2410a1da:9

value
17167493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c14f1b9f289f8b90e542a356accd20e368481e3b OP_EQUAL
address
3KK975bgLwfiqAwbJv6Rm8ZGk9pVZxcekP
transaction
56813e30cb22e0d7f00587659dae819d94e427372102c57f5d57d64f2410a1da
confirmations
360708
spent
true